#2f499c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#2f499c is composed of 18.4% red, 28.6% green and 61.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 69.9% cyan, 53.2% magenta, 0% yellow and 38.8% black. It has a hue angle of 225.7 degrees, a saturation of 53.7% and a lightness of 39.8%. #2f499c color hex could be obtained by blending #5e92ff with #000039. Closest websafe color is: #333399.

#2f499c color description : Dark moderate blue.

#2f499c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#2f499c has RGB values of R:47, G:73, B:156 and CMYK values of C:0.7, M:0.53, Y:0, K:0.39. Its decimal value is 3099036.

Shades and Tints of #2f499c

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020205 is the darkest color, while #f5f7fc is the lightest one.

Tones of #2f499c

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#5e616d is the less saturated color, while #0031cb is the most saturated one.
